The brakes arent affected at all they still seem shrp but they are squealing when i brake anyone know how get rid off this cheers

Strip the brakes down, clean up the pad carriers with a wire brush, put copper grease on the carrier and the back of the pads.
If that doesn't sort it, then try changing the pads for some decent ones, ie. from vw.
